Output e0431a2026576c17b5a5efa1ca53c77ff0643d89f403a77619a55584d3865010:0

value
951797
script pubkey
OP_DUP OP_HASH160 OP_PUSHBYTES_20 c6402873c0961654d8ce58498bcecf1970cda80f OP_EQUALVERIFY OP_CHECKSIG
address
1K5Fem46fTpdvr2vJy6V49SGyQo83VavEs
transaction
e0431a2026576c17b5a5efa1ca53c77ff0643d89f403a77619a55584d3865010
confirmations
655934
spent
true